OpenClaw Skill 的.zip安装指南:从下载到部署的完整解决方案

1次阅读
没有评论

共计 1405 个字符,预计需要花费 4 分钟才能阅读完成。

image.webp

背景与痛点

OpenClaw Skill 是一个功能强大的自动化工具,广泛应用于数据处理、网络爬虫和自动化测试等领域。然而,许多开发者在安装其.zip 文件时常常遇到各种问题,比如依赖缺失、环境变量配置错误、权限问题等。这些问题不仅浪费时间,还可能导致安装失败。本文将详细介绍如何正确安装 OpenClaw Skill 的.zip 文件,避免常见的安装陷阱。

OpenClaw Skill 的.zip 安装指南:从下载到部署的完整解决方案

环境准备

在开始安装之前,确保你的系统满足以下要求:

  • 操作系统:Windows 10/11、macOS 10.15+ 或 Linux(Ubuntu 20.04+)
  • Python 版本:3.8 或更高
  • 内存:至少 4GB
  • 磁盘空间:至少 2GB 可用空间

此外,还需要安装以下依赖项:

  • pip(Python 包管理工具)
  • virtualenv(可选,推荐用于隔离环境)
  • Git(用于克隆仓库,可选)

安装步骤

  1. 下载 OpenClaw Skill 的.zip 文件

从官方网站或 GitHub 仓库下载最新的.zip 文件。确保下载的是稳定版本,而非开发版。

  1. 解压.zip 文件

使用解压工具(如 WinRAR、7-Zip 或系统自带的解压工具)将.zip 文件解压到目标文件夹。建议解压到一个干净的目录,避免路径中包含空格或特殊字符。

  1. 创建虚拟环境(可选)

如果你希望隔离安装环境,可以使用以下命令创建虚拟环境:

python -m venv openclaw_env
source openclaw_env/bin/activate  # Linux/macOS
openclaw_env\Scripts\activate     # Windows

  1. 安装依赖

进入解压后的文件夹,运行以下命令安装依赖:

pip install -r requirements.txt

  1. 配置环境变量

某些功能可能需要配置环境变量。例如,如果 OpenClaw Skill 需要访问 API 密钥,可以将其添加到环境变量中:

export OPENCLAW_API_KEY="your_api_key"  # Linux/macOS
set OPENCLAW_API_KEY="your_api_key"     # Windows

  1. 运行安装脚本

如果.zip 文件中包含安装脚本(如setup.py),运行以下命令完成安装:

python setup.py install

代码示例

以下是一个简单的 Python 脚本示例,用于验证 OpenClaw Skill 是否安装成功:

import openclaw

# 初始化 OpenClaw Skill
claw = openclaw.Claw()

# 执行一个简单的任务
result = claw.execute_task("sample_task")
print(result)

避坑指南

  • 依赖冲突 :如果安装过程中出现依赖冲突,可以尝试使用pip install --ignore-installed 强制安装。
  • 权限问题 :在 Linux/macOS 上,可能需要使用sudo 命令提升权限。但建议尽量避免,以免引发安全问题。
  • 路径错误:确保所有路径都是绝对路径或正确相对路径,避免因路径问题导致文件找不到。

性能与安全

  • 性能优化:如果 OpenClaw Skill 运行缓慢,可以尝试禁用不必要的插件或模块。
  • 安全配置:确保 API 密钥和其他敏感信息存储在环境变量中,而非硬编码在脚本中。

结语

通过本文的指导,你应该已经成功安装了 OpenClaw Skill 的.zip 文件。如果在安装过程中遇到任何问题,欢迎在评论区留言分享你的经验。动手实践是掌握技术的最佳方式,祝你使用愉快!

正文完
 0
评论(没有评论)